Our First Week As A Family Of Four ♥

As you may have read or seen on social media, our beautiful baby boy Beau Samuel James arrived into the world last Thursday and our lives as a family of four began. It's been a crazy, amazing week and a rather busy one - as you can imagine, life with a very active three year old and a newborn baby means that the days are all just melting into one, Jacek and I have barely had a chance to eat or have a drink! It's all worth it though and we're so lucky to be blessed with two beautiful and healthy boys.


Beau and I were discharged from hospital on Sunday and I was beyond anxious to get home. I missed Tyler Lee so much and it was breaking my heart hearing him on the phone saying "I miss you mummy", him and I have spent everyday together for three years so being apart was a big adjustment for us both. I was so emotional and teary in hospital, especially as Beau was getting blood tests done due to his jandice, my poor baby has had blood taken from him eight times now and he's only a week old tonight.

Tyler Lee is still a bit cautious about his new brother. He does interact with the baby, he says good morning and good night, he's asked to hold him and says he loves him but he has been upset about him being here and has been acting up a bit. One minute he's so affectionate and the next minute he can be crying or trying to hit for no reason at all. I think it's all for attention as he feels a bit threatened by the baby's presence or that he may be forgotten about. Jacek and I have been trying to reassure him that everything is okay and have been spending as much time with him as possible but it's going to take awhile for him to come around to having Beau here I think.

Amazingly, Jacek and I have been able to take the boys out everyday. It does take awhile to leave the house through feeds, nappy changes, clothing changes, packing bags, etc. but we have gotten out and that's an achievement in itself for us! It's lovely being out and about in the sunshine with our boys and I think getting out together is helping Tyler Lee adjust to life with the baby as he's seeing that he can still do things and go places with mummy and daddy.

Beau has been sleeping really well too. His main feeding times are from 7.30 in the morning, where he could have two bottles in close succession to each other and the same from 7.30 in the night, but he then sleeps from 9.30/10 until 2.30/3, stays awake until around 4 and is then asleep until 7 when Tyler Lee comes into our room to say good morning. We've been blessed and we're so grateful as I'm not sure we could function without our sleep!

I'm not going to lie, our washing machine has been going non-stop, the house has been in absolute chaos at times and Jacek and I have been absolutely starving at times from not having time to eat through looking after the boys, but it's actually been more manageable than I thought it would be! I'm actually surprised that we've had playground trips, walks, photo sessions (even though Tyler Lee won't let us take a picture of him at the moment) and everything in between. I thought we'd be living like hermits for at least another week or two but we're doing well.

So that's been our first week as a family of four and it's been a lovely one. I just hope I can keep the routine up when Jacek returns to work at the weekend. We're loving life as a foursome and we know it'll just get even better once Tyler Lee gets used to Beau more and is back to his happy chappy self. Any tips on how to reassure a toddler and help them to be more accepting towards a new sibling would be greatly appreciated.
